Organizations that do not provide disability services

Whether you are looking to start a new organization or you want to expand your existing organization, it is important to understand the roles that organizations play in the disability services world. Many of them are designed to serve a specific disability. However, others represent the entire disability community.

The Individuals with Disabilities Education Act, (IDEA), protects the rights and allows for discretionary grants to non-profit organizations, research and technology development, and research. It also provides financial assistance to local districts and parent education. Similarly, Section 504 of the Rehabilitation Act of 1973 prohibits discrimination against individuals with disabilities. It also guarantees that no otherwise qualified person with a disability shall be denied the benefits of public programs.

Organizations serve many other purposes, in addition to fulfilling their legal obligations. Organizations offer individuals with disabilities the opportunity to share information and discuss relevant issues. They might also run school programs or speakers’ boards.

Career options for people with disabilities

There are many career options available for people with disabilities working in disability services, whether you are looking for work or looking for a new job. These include teaching, vocational rehabilitation, and employment as a home health aide. Some may require indirect assistance such as helping people get a job or education. These options are available in almost all industries.

Some of these options include job fairs, resume banks, and job search services. Ability Links is an online resume bank and job board that targets people with disabilities and their families. Ability Links offers a job search tool as well as a salary comparison tool. It also provides job alerts and articles about job search. It’s free to sign up.

There are also several Career Centers that provide employment services to people with disabilities. These centers provide computer workshops, career counseling, placement assistance, and job search resources. They are open to all, but individuals can also make individual appointments. The Career Center Locator link can be used to locate the nearest Career Center.
